GB/T 28686-2012
ActiveGas turbines thermodynamic performance tests

This standard specifies the test methods, calculation procedures, and correction rules for determining the thermodynamic performance of gas turbines, including power output, heat rate, and thermal efficiency. It is applied in the energy and power generation industry for acceptance testing, performance verification, and commissioning of gas turbine units in power plants, industrial facilities, and combined-cycle systems. The standard ensures consistent and accurate evaluation of gas turbine performance under specified operating conditions, supporting contractual compliance and operational optimization.
